Latest Patents

One of his latest patents is an optical fiber connector that features a housing unit with a resilient retaining arm member. This connector includes an operating unit with a pivot seat and a hook member that allows for the easy removal of an adapter from the optical fiber connector. Another patent involves an optical fiber connector with a main body unit that has a guiding groove and two position limiting portions. This design enables the coupling members to move between non-working and working positions, enhancing the functionality of the connector.
